Fetch TV rolls out new features and an updated interface
Fetch TV has rolled out a suite of new features for its users, including the addition of channel favourites and an Integrated Universal Search which allows consumers to search across the entire Fetch platform for content.
CEO Scott Lorson said the latest update is part of an ongoing transformation for the platform.
